First, you should fold the paper correctly. Of course, the best thing to look like is a roundsnowflake; therefore, as a preform, you can first cut out circles of paper. But you can also use an ordinary square. Following a simple scheme, you will soon learn to cut beautiful snowflakes.



There are several ways in which you can fold paper to make snowflakes. The easiest way is to fold the paper inthe form of regular triangles. Take an ordinary square and bend it in half so that you have a triangle. The resulting triangle is folded again in half in the middle. You will again have a regular shape triangle. Now the triangle should be folded in half so that its upper point does not move, that is, divide it in half only its lower side. And fold the triangle in the same way again. As a result, you will get a very narrow triangle with a "tail" that looks out from above. It can be cut off. This form is perfect for cutting out different patterns. None of the sides of the triangle can be cut completely, otherwise the snowflake will disintegrate.



The above-mentioned method most often adds round blanks. But if you fold the square in this way and cut off the "tail" that is formed after folding, you will get a snowflake of a hexagonal shape.

Before making a snowflake, draw a pattern on it that you would like to cut out. The easiest way to cut out the patterns created byhelp straight lines. Various whorls look very good, but it's much harder to cut them out. We give you some schemes of paper snowflakes, which you can cut out with the children. In the end, all you have to do is just deploy the snowflake. Draw these patterns on triangular blanks and just cut them along the lines. Do not cut the sides!

Before you cut out snowflakes from paper, stock up with enough colored and white paper. Cut snowflakes from paper is very interesting,so your children will be delighted with this lesson. But snowflakes, cut from paper white napkins, will perfectly serve as scenery on the windows. Snowflakes from more dense paper can be used as decorations on curtains.



Cut out snowflakes can also be hung to the ceiling on a thin thread. And miniature snowflakes from paper perfectlyfit as an ornament on the New Year tree. Now you know how to make a snowflake. Try now to decorate the room with children with colorful snowflakes!
